Interactive tree of Amy Knapp

Amy Knapp 17771846
Jessie Cooley
John Holmes
Michael Byrd
Jabez Knapp 17521801
Hannah Holley 17601799
Caleb Knapp 17241767
Amy Rundell 17301835
Caleb Knapp 16981762
Clemens Mills
Caleb Knapp 16771750
Sarah Rundell 1678
William Rundle
Mary Reynolds
Abigail Mills
X Holly
X Drake
John Drake
X Oldfield